Kuala Lumpur
Opportunity expired
Our purpose is reimagining energy for people and our planet. Our ambition is to be a net zero company by 2050 or sooner. We want to be an energy company with purpose; one that is trusted by society, valued by shareholders, and motivating for everyone who works at bp. We’re building an IT organization that can drive our business ambitions, by being first into markets and delivering efficiencies through automation, machine learning and artificial intelligence. We are building a culture of success and providing our IT professionals the opportunities to grow and embrace the technologies to deliver our ambitions.
Service, Software & Platform engineering underpins all that we do. It enables our business aspirations and helps turn our net zero ambitions into a reality. As a graduate, you will help shape the future of bp.
As a Service Engineer, you will be embedded within a dynamic engineering-focused team, learning about new platform products and services. You will execute operational support activities according to documented service procedures and work instructions and help your team to deliver service improvements that maximize operational efficiency
As a Software Engineer, you will be embedded within one of our software engineering teams and will learn the approaches and techniques to deliver business value. You will be exposed to new technologies and learn to develop new solutions and products. You’ll be developing enterprise software primarily using Java J2EE / C#.Net or other high-level languages. Learn about low-code platforms such as Salesforce, Service Now and Microsoft PowerApps. You will be exposed to responsive mobile/web application development using React Native / Xamarin or other modern frameworks.
As a Platform Engineer, you will be embedded within one of our platform engineering teams and will learn the approaches and techniques to deliver high value, highly scalable and resilient platforms to support the enterprise. You will be exposed to new technologies and learn to build, maintain, and administer platforms across the enterprise. You will learn about our automation frameworks and will have the opportunity to develop your complex scripting (typically Python) skills and support microservices development.
Analytical and logical, you’ll be keen on software development and looking to learn and collaborate among our skilled software developers.
As this is a technical role if you are successful in progressing to the on-demand video interview stage a short coding test will follow the interview. Your responses to the coding test will be reviewed alongside the other elements of the assessment process; the test is not pass or fail.
Diversity sits at the heart of our company and as an equal opportunity employer, we stay true to our mission by ensuring that our place can be anyone's place. We do not discriminate based on race, religion, colour, national origin, gender identity, sexual orientation, age, marital status, veteran status or disability status.
1,000 - 50,000 employees
Energy & Utilities
Malaysia has been a market for the corporation since 1964. Today, with company's operations spanning a variety of business models.